- (continued from previous page)In poor Fairy Hall
With writs and with processes
I serve by the score
Widows and orphans
I could not do more
Some I evicted
But not quite them all
But now their curses
Fall on sweet Fairy Hall
Bad luck to Killean
And his leaguering for land
McLoughlin and Gannon
With their new music band
It's the only one thing
Has caused me don't fail
I opposed the good price
And broke up the sale.
For there are ranches around me
I wanted them all
To make a big grazing farm
In sweet Fairy Hall
In Drum Heldree I seized
The hens, ducks, chickens, asses and sows
Duffy, Murray, the Coxes
The Keane's one and all
They would break through a rank
Though as strong as a wall(continues on next page)- Informant
